The 15th edition of the ICC U19 Men’s Cricket World Cup is around the corner, with emerging talents from 16 teams gearing up to compete for the coveted title in South Africa. The tournament began in 1988, and has seen seven different winners in the 14 editions so far. India lead the way with five titles to their name, followed by Australia (3), Pakistan (2), Bangladesh, South Africa, West Indies and England (1 each). And over the years, the tournament has gone through many iterations, providing a foundational stage for many of the game’s superstars. It’s part of the magic of the U19 Cricket World Cup.
